1. An alarm system comprising:

  • a base communication device configured to communicate wireless signals within a range of frequencies;

    a remote communication device configured to communicate with the base communication device using the wireless signals, wherein the remote communication device is adapted to be associated with an article to be secured and wherein the remote communication device comprises alarm circuitry;

    wherein the remote communication device comprises an antenna circuit configured to receive the wireless signals communicated by the base communication device and to generate first electrical signals corresponding to respective ones of the received wireless signals, and the remote communication device further comprises a detector comprising a non-linear device configured to receive the first electrical signals and to provide second electrical signals having a non-linear relationship to the first electrical signals, wherein the detector further comprises a parallel LC circuit configured to provide increased impedance at the range of frequencies of the wireless signals compared with other frequencies outside of the range of frequencies; and

    wherein the remote communication device further comprises processing circuitry coupled with the non-linear device and configured to process the second electrical signals and to control the alarm circuitry to generate a human perceptible alarm responsive to the processing.
